Frequently Asked Questions
Where is Mississippi River located?
The Mississippi River winds through the central United States, passing through states like Minnesota, Wisconsin, Iowa, Illinois, Missouri, Kentucky, Tennessee, Arkansas, Mississippi, and Louisiana before reaching the Gulf of Mexico. Its banks host diverse communities and landscapes shaped by the river.
When is the best time to visit Mississippi River?
Late spring and early fall are frequently suggested, as temperatures are milder and local events often take place. Summer provides lush scenery but can feel humid, while winter attracts those interested in quieter river landscapes.
What are some things to do near Mississippi River?
You can explore riverfront parks, nature trails, and historic sites, or join boat tours to learn about local wildlife and history. The area also has museums, cultural events, and opportunities for fishing or paddling.
How is the weather near Mississippi River?
Winters are generally cold, ranging from 22–44°F (-5–7°C), while summers reach 83–88°F (28–31°C) with humid conditions. Spring and fall are often recommended for milder temperatures and changing scenery along the river.
